About This Book
The narrative unfolds in a small riverside village around a merchant's household, shifting between meticulous domestic detail and the circulation of neighborly talk. Daily routines of trade and home life are interrupted by reminders of past losses and displays of vanity, while a careless young helper and a wife's careful preparations suggest deeper tensions. Gossip and suspicion spread through the community, gradually exposing concealed grievances and moral ambiguities. The work traces how private sorrow, social reputation, and economic anxieties entangle, driving a steady unravelling of relationships and reshaping the quiet order of village life.
